Effectively-known backyard centre on the market for £2m after hitting difficulties

The centre was owned by the identical household for 42 years

Sturmer Backyard Centre, positioned in Sturmer close to Haverhill, is available on the market (Picture: Streetview)

A widely known backyard centre within the South East has been put up on the market for £2 million after hitting difficulties. Sturmer Backyard Centre, positioned in Sturmer close to Haverhill, is available on the market following monetary difficulties linked to a significant provide chain drawback.

It follows quite a lot of excessive profile closures within the trade. Dobbies Backyard Centres closed eight of its backyard centres between January and March final yr.

The closures had been websites in Rugby, Morpeth, Stapleton, Havant, Hare Hatch, Leicester, Aylesbury and Northampton. This got here after a turbulent interval for the corporate, which has been reassessing its nationwide portfolio amid rising operational prices and shifting client behaviour.

In a press release, a Dobbies spokesperson mentioned the choice fashioned a part of a strategic plan to strengthen the enterprise and enhance its profitability. “The restructuring plan and different strategic initiatives are anticipated to return Dobbies to sustainable profitability by way of website rationalisations, hire reductions, and different tangible price financial savings,” the spokesperson mentioned.

Sturmer Backyard Centre, on the Essex-Suffolk border and covers round 2.76 acres, has traded beneath the identical household possession since 1982 till 2024. Sturmer Backyard Centre is being marketed by Christie & Co. The positioning is interesting to each established backyard centre operators searching for enlargement and owner-operators searching for a long-standing, respected enterprise, the property agent says.

The property additionally consists of a big glasshouse and a former retail retailer, each of which could possibly be repurposed to broaden retail choices or introduce new concessions. The centre is run by house owners who took over the location in 2024, and are supported by 13 full-time employees and 6 further weekend employees for the bistro.

A spokesman for the backyard centre says the monetary loss from a provide chain concern final yr proved too nice to beat. A spokesman for the backyard centre mentioned: “It clearly hit us very laborious and so the choice to go available on the market was made.”

The provision chain points left them with out key merchandise in the course of the top of the rising season final yr, their “most important buying and selling interval”, which led to giant monetary losses.

Since sharing the information of the loss with prospects earlier this yr, the backyard centre launched a crowdfunding marketing campaign, which was closely requested by guests and people on-line.

The spokesman additionally cited pressures of the financial system and gasoline prices as causes behind placing the location available on the market, though they are saying the present house owners would love to have the ability to keep.
